Deleting an element from the Layout window

Available with Production Mapping license.

You can use the Layout window to delete an element from the page layout.

  1. Start ArcMap.
  2. Load data in the map if necessary.
  3. Switch to layout view.
  4. If necessary, click the Layout window button Layout window on the Production Cartography toolbar to display the Layout window.
  5. Select one or more elements in the Layout window.
  6. Right-click inside the Layout window and click Delete.

    The element is removed from the page layout and the Layout window.

    Note:

    Deleting an element only removes it from the page layout, not from an element database.
